Step 2: Storefront or service area?
- Customers visit this address during stated hours.
- There is permanent signage on the building or window. Not a vehicle magnet or sandwich board.
- The address is the real operating location. No PO box, mailbox store or virtual office.
- Any "no" above: set up as a service area business and hide the address.
Steps 3 to 5: Fix rules
- Name matches the sign. No added city, services or keywords. Trading name beats legal name.
- Phone is answered by a person. Auto-attendant off. Landline is fine for the call option; only a mobile can receive a text.
- Do not swap a landline for a mobile just to chase SMS verification. Google picks the method.
- Address matches door, licence and website, unit number and abbreviation style included.
- Primary category is accurate. Leave secondary categories until after verification.
- Website contact page shows the same name, address and phone as the profile.
Mismatches found on this page are the work. Fix them on the website first (you control it), then on the profile, then wait.

Step 6: Submit and wait
- Claim the profile with the owner's account and correct each field from the dashboard.
- If the dashboard says verify first: Suggest an edit on Google Maps from an account with a clean contribution history, one field per edit.
- Check signed out until the public listing is correct. Human review can take weeks.
- No verification request while a name or address edit is pending.
Step 7: Accounts
- Primary owner = the business owner's established Google account.
- Helpers added as managers. Never handed the owner login.
- Domain email on the profile if the business has one.
- Website verified in Search Console under the owner's account.
Step 8: Documents business name on each must match the profile
- Business licence
- Certificate of incorporation or registration
- WCB clearance (trades)
- Insurance or bonding certificate
- Utility bill for the address, in the business name
- Recent customer invoice with name, address, phone in the header
Step 9: Request verification from the owner's account. Take what Google offers. Then touch nothing
| Phone or text | Business phone beside you, unmuted, auto-attendant off. Landline: choose "Phone". Enter the code immediately. |
| Email | Signed into that mailbox first. Check spam. Follow the link from the same device. |
| Postcard | Up to 14 days. Code expires after 30. No edits to name, address or category while waiting. No second card unless the first is certainly lost. |
| Video recording | Live in the Google Maps app, signed into the managing account. Cannot be pre-recorded. Use the shoot storyboard. Review up to 5 business days. |
| Live video call | Through support after other methods fail. Same evidence: location, signage or vehicle, an owner-only area. |
Do not resubmit while a review is pending. Repeated attempts can trigger a "No more ways to verify" lockout. If locked out, use Google's verification status tool to open a support ticket and ask for a live video call.
Step 10: After approval
- Leave name, address, category and phone alone unless genuinely wrong.
- Add the safe things first: photos, services, description, posts.
- If a core field must change, one at a time, and let it publish before the next.
- Owner stays primary owner. Helpers stay managers.
